) monitors the natural hazards
in Iceland closely 24/7 through real-time measurements of
earthquakes, GPS and other data. In case of a sudden change in the
activity, the IMO specialists alarm the Civil Protection authorities
immediately which act if considered necessary in
order to
respond to a possible emergency. Due to the recent seismic activity on the Reykjanes Peninsula, the
